Peak birth month each year and the daily birth rate that month in New Zealand
New Zealand: Peak birth month each year and the daily birth rate that month was 32.46 births per million people in 2020. ▼ Falling
Peak birth month each year and the daily birth rate that month in New Zealand, 1980–2020
Source: Human Mortality Database (2025) – processed by Our World in Data. Measured in births per million people.
Analysis
New Zealand recorded 32.46 births per million people for peak birth month each year and the daily birth rate that month in 2020. That is the lowest value across all 41 years on record.
The figure is down 2.3% on the previous year and down 22.3% over ten years.
Over the whole period, peak birth month each year and the daily birth rate that month in New Zealand peaked at 54.44 births per million people in 1990 and was at its lowest, 32.46 births per million people, in 2020.
That places New Zealand 9th out of 40 countries with data for 2020, putting it in the top qu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 41 years of available data.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1980s | 48.43 births per million people | 45.63 births per million people | 52.74 births per million people | 10 |
| 1990s | 47.1 births per million people | 42.88 births per million people | 54.44 births per million people | 10 |
| 2000s | 41.33 births per million people | 39.82 births per million people | 43.27 births per million people | 10 |
| 2010s | 36.97 births per million people | 33.24 births per million people | 41.81 births per million people | 10 |
| 2020s | 32.46 births per million people | 32.46 births per million people | 32.46 births per million people | 1 |
